diff options
author | Ben Gamari <ben@smart-cactus.org> | 2018-11-26 17:21:12 -0500 |
---|---|---|
committer | Marge Bot <ben+marge-bot@smart-cactus.org> | 2019-03-05 22:22:40 -0500 |
commit | 37f257afcd6a52cf4d76c60d766b1aeb520b9f05 (patch) | |
tree | ac800e46fbf94c16ce39170f4a720637b07dde06 /aclocal.m4 | |
parent | 646b6dfbe125aa756a935e840979ba11b4a882c0 (diff) | |
download | haskell-37f257afcd6a52cf4d76c60d766b1aeb520b9f05.tar.gz |
Rip out object splitting
The splitter is an evil Perl script that processes assembler code.
Its job can be done better by the linker's --gc-sections flag. GHC
passes this flag to the linker whenever -split-sections is passed on
the command line.
This is based on @DemiMarie's D2768.
Fixes Trac #11315
Fixes Trac #9832
Fixes Trac #8964
Fixes Trac #8685
Fixes Trac #8629
Diffstat (limited to 'aclocal.m4')
-rw-r--r-- | aclocal.m4 | 20 |
1 files changed, 0 insertions, 20 deletions
diff --git a/aclocal.m4 b/aclocal.m4 index 9d2390e840..1647119e03 100644 --- a/aclocal.m4 +++ b/aclocal.m4 @@ -476,7 +476,6 @@ AC_DEFUN([FP_SETTINGS], SettingsLdCommand="\$tooldir/${mingw_bin_prefix}ld.exe" SettingsArCommand="\$tooldir/${mingw_bin_prefix}ar.exe" SettingsRanlibCommand="\$tooldir/${mingw_bin_prefix}ranlib.exe" - SettingsPerlCommand='$tooldir/perl/perl.exe' SettingsDllWrapCommand="\$tooldir/${mingw_bin_prefix}dllwrap.exe" SettingsWindresCommand="\$tooldir/${mingw_bin_prefix}windres.exe" SettingsTouchCommand='$topdir/bin/touchy.exe' @@ -488,7 +487,6 @@ AC_DEFUN([FP_SETTINGS], SettingsHaskellCPPFlags="$HaskellCPPArgs" SettingsLdCommand="$(basename $LdCmd)" SettingsArCommand="$(basename $ArCmd)" - SettingsPerlCommand="$(basename $PerlCmd)" SettingsDllWrapCommand="$(basename $DllWrapCmd)" SettingsWindresCommand="$(basename $WindresCmd)" SettingsTouchCommand='$topdir/bin/touchy.exe' @@ -499,7 +497,6 @@ AC_DEFUN([FP_SETTINGS], SettingsLdCommand="$LdCmd" SettingsArCommand="$ArCmd" SettingsRanlibCommand="$RanlibCmd" - SettingsPerlCommand="$PerlCmd" if test -z "$DllWrapCmd" then SettingsDllWrapCommand="/bin/false" @@ -552,7 +549,6 @@ AC_DEFUN([FP_SETTINGS], AC_SUBST(SettingsLdFlags) AC_SUBST(SettingsArCommand) AC_SUBST(SettingsRanlibCommand) - AC_SUBST(SettingsPerlCommand) AC_SUBST(SettingsDllWrapCommand) AC_SUBST(SettingsWindresCommand) AC_SUBST(SettingsLibtoolCommand) @@ -1327,22 +1323,6 @@ AC_DEFUN([FP_GCC_SUPPORTS_NO_PIE], rm -f conftest.c conftest.o conftest ]) -dnl Small feature test for perl version. Assumes PerlCmd -dnl contains path to perl binary. -dnl -dnl (Perl versions prior to v5.6 does not contain the string "v5"; -dnl instead they display version strings such as "version 5.005".) -dnl -AC_DEFUN([FPTOOLS_CHECK_PERL_VERSION], -[$PerlCmd -v >conftest.out 2>&1 - if grep "v5" conftest.out >/dev/null 2>&1; then - : - else - AC_MSG_ERROR([your version of perl probably won't work, try upgrading it.]) - fi -rm -fr conftest* -]) - # FP_CHECK_PROG(VARIABLE, PROG-TO-CHECK-FOR, # [VALUE-IF-NOT-FOUND], [PATH], [REJECT]) |